How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Job description

    Location: London
    Contract: Ongoing Contract Outside IR35
    Shift Pattern: Days or Nights available
    Rate: Up to £330 per shift, dependent on experience and shift pattern & Van, Fuel card provided.
    We are seeking an experienced Air conditioning engineer to work across a portfolio of commercial sites throughout London.
    The role will focus primarily on the maintenance and repair of Airedale HVAC and air-conditioning units, requiring strong fault-finding and diagnostic skills. The successful engineer must be comfortable working independently, responding to faults and completing repairs to a high standard.
    Key Responsibilities
    * Carry out fault finding and diagnostics on Airedale HVAC units.
    * Identify mechanical, electrical and refrigeration-related faults.
    * Complete repairs and replace defective components.
    * Conduct planned and reactive maintenance.
    * Test systems following repairs to confirm safe and effective operation.
    * Record completed works, faults identified and parts used.
    * Travel between commercial sites across London.
    Essential Requirements
    * Valid F-Gas certification as a minimum.
    * Proven experience working as an HVAC or air-conditioning engineer.
    * Strong fault-finding, diagnostic and repair experience.
    * Experience working on Airedale units or similar commercial HVAC equipment.
    * Full UK driving licence.
    * Willingness to work either day or night shifts.
    * Ability to work independently and manage multiple site requirements.
    Desirable Experience
    * Relevant City & Guilds or NVQ qualification in Refrigeration and Air Conditioning.
    * Experience working in commercial or critical environments.
    * Knowledge of electrical controls and HVAC control systems
